A Bug’s Life: Want to Pollinate?

In “A Bug’s Life,” two inebriated flies head to P.T. Flea’s Circus. That’s when one of them hits on Francis the ladybug, and throws in a pollinating pickup line that is definitely not safe to put in a kids’ movie.

 

The Santa Clause: Drug Joke

In “The Santa Clause,” Charlie gets in the sleigh and has the surprise of his life when he and Santa go airborne. “You’re flying!” Charlie exclaims. Then Santa, played by Tim Allen, says, “It’s okay. I lived through the ‘60s.” The line makes light of the fact that a lot of people were high as a kite in those days.
